Relationship between Oral Function and Support/Care-Need Certification in Japanese Older People Aged ≥ 75 Years: A Three-Year Cohort Study

Int. J. Environ. Res. Public Health 2022, 19(24), 16959; https://doi.org/10.3390/ijerph192416959
by Komei Iwai 1, Tetsuji Azuma 1, Takatoshi Yonenaga 1, Taketsugu Nomura 2, Iwane Sugiura 2, Yujo Inagawa 2, Yusuke Matsumoto 2, Seiji Nakashima 2, Yoshikazu Abe 2 and Takaaki Tomofuji 1,*

Reviewer 1 Report

This was an interesting study on the relationship of oral function with the likelihood for using the NHI.

Title: I find the title too long: Perhaps shorten it to "Relationship between Oral Function and Support/care-need Certification in Japanese Older People Aged ≥ 75 Years: A Three-year Cohort Study"

Abstract:

1) Line 15: The aim was to examine the relationships between oral functions and support/care-need 15 certification in 732 older people aged ≥ 75 years using the National Health Insurance database system (KDB) and data from Kani City, Gifu, Japan: Sample size should not be mentioned in the aim but part of the methods/results. It is also not suitable to have an abbreviation KDB that is shown early on next the a phrase that does not have the initials. For non-Japanese, I find it confusing that the authors use KDB instead of NHI. I would like to suggest that the authors use the abbreviation NHI throughout the text. However, if they wish to introduce the term Kokuho, use the example from their government's website: National Health Insurance (NHI; also known as "Kokuho") database.

2) Line 18: As oral functions, chewing state, tongue and lip function, and swallowing function were investigated: I don't understand what this sentence.

3) Line 23: At follow-up, 121 (17%) participants had support/care-need certification: You should state in the methods that the subjects included those without certification at the beginning.

4) Line 31: Please rephrase the final sentence to sound like a conclusion.

Introduction

1) Lines 38 and 42: In the first sentence, is the data referring to Japanese population or world population?

2) Line 47: are the values 1-2 and 1-5 referring to the types or level? 

3) Line 67: This is an international journal. It is hard to remember a foreign word as a policy and I confuse myself thinking this is a location.  As mentioned above, it would be less confusing to non-Japanese if the term National Health Insurance (NHI; also known as "Kokuho") database is used instead. Then you can refer later in the text as NHI database. Alternatively, you can state as National Health Insurance (also known as "Kokuho") database (NHID), and refer in the subsequent text as NHID. I prefer the former. as in line 97, the term National Health Insurance database was used as the heading. So I think you should be consistent with the term used.

4) Line 79: Wouldn't it be better to be more specific and refer this study as a cohort study?

Materials and methods

1) Line 84: Please cite the data source e.g. name of the government/institution body who kept the database in Kani City.

2) Line 110: Are both codes 1 and 2 have the same interpretation "periodontal pockets ≥ 4 mm"?

3) Line 111: The questionnaire items in chewing state included “It is harder to eat hard food than it was six months ago (presence or absence)”. Participants who answered "absence" were defined as poor chewing state: Shouldn't it be the opposite? having to agree (presence) to this statement, then the participant agreed that they found it hard to chew. So if they stated absent, they would have good chewing state.

Results

1) Table 2 title "Baseline characteristics of participants with support/care-need certification and participants without support/care-need certification at follow-u": the word should be "follow-up" i.e. missing letter p. secondly, I find it confusing for using the term baseline. I thought this referred to the time in 2017. but at follow up it is in 2020. I also found the values in brackets next to the numbers of absent or present confusing. I see the legend indicate explained for continuous variables and values in brackets referred to proportions. But what are the non continuous variables referring to? absolute number, n? I am not sure how the values within each row relate to the values of the columns. Could you make the table easier to understand? 

Discussion

1) Line 182: The results of the present study suggest that the dental risk factors for certification of the need for care and support can be elucidated with content appropriate for each individual municipality by matching them with the KDB. It is desirable to have a database of the results of dental check-ups to match them with the KDB: I don't understand what the sentences were trying to suggest. Do you mean to suggest for the municipality to provide data of the dental risk factors to NHI? To what benefit would that do, would that then cause the NHI to impose higher charges to those with dental risk factors because they are likely to have the need for care? Perhaps knowing the authors could suggest to the government to increase prevention strategies that target those with poor chewing state and swallowing function because they're likely to be malnourished and have to get care later.

Conclusion

1) Line 240: Japanese older people aged ≥ 75 years with poor chewing state and poor swallowing function 241 have a higher risk for future support/care-need certification: Can you rephrase, Japanese older people aged ≥ 75 years with poor chewing state and poor swallowing function AT BASELINE have a higher risk for future support/care-need certification.

Reviewer 2 Report

Normality can better be investigated by the Shapiro-Wilk test.

p.5 l.3 associated seems better than ``correlated’’ as the latter is not computed, see also elsewhere.

The somewhat vague expression ``was associated’’ is repeated quite often, whereas the risk interpretations of the ODDs ratios is lacking from the manuscript. Such would increase clarity of the findings. Making such interpretations would also sustain the final conclusion better.

p. 7 top: The discussed point about FP and FN is in principle justified, but it seems better to find literature to make this more specific and/or to add that the degree in which this occurs is currently unknown.
